Collection Box Fundraising Volunteer
What You'll Do:
Research and contact local places that will hold a collection tin
Deliver and swap collection tins in your own time
Record donations and thanking local businesses and supporters
Sharing your passion for cat welfare and promoting the work of Cats Protection
Why You'll Love It:
Every penny counts when it comes to improving the lives of the thousands of cats and kittens across the UK that need our help each year. Our collection box fundraising volunteers help our volunteer groups raise vital funds by collecting and distributing collection boxes in their local area. Making a difference can mean as little as raising 20p, which is enough to feed one cat in our care for a day, to £150 which is the average cost of a cat in our care.

What We're Looking For:
Overseeing the collection and delivery of collection boxes in different locations
Recording donations and thanking local businesses and supporters
Researching local areas for collection box ‘hot spots’
Sharing fundraising ideas with other volunteers and putting these into practice
Sharing your passion for cat welfare and promoting the work of Cats Protection
Our collection box fundraising volunteers usually spend 1 to 2 hours per week in this role, which is flexible and can be shared by more than one volunteer if needed.
